Transaction 0762762137841377505b7966c3ae17cd56148db8d2b5946dcd3c98a89345d0a5
1 Input
1 Output
-
0762762137841377505b7966c3ae17cd56148db8d2b5946dcd3c98a89345d0a5:0
- value
- 71589
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4943a9d25e013b3ab1588f11a21b7292e184c79 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HTpCfBBYaDm9s9uv44SQUL4GDVJCURMvQ